LIVERMORE, CA -- Novazone, a company that makes food and water purification technology, said that it had raised $7 million in a Series B round of funding. New investor Chrysalix Energy led the round, with continued participation from existing investors Foundation Capital and Grauer Capital. The company uses ozone, which comes from oxygen, to sanitize and store food and water. The result allows both to have increased shelf life and safer handling.
